Dera Bassi, September 21

Two migrant labourers from Barauli village died here at the Civil Hospital, here, reportedly due to excessive consumption of cannabis and liquor here on Friday.

Deceased Bagirath Paswan (35) and Uskeen Paswan (30), who hailed from Bihar but were currently putting up at Barauli village in Dera Bassi, were brought to the Civil Hospital by their family members after they were found unconscious. However, they died while undergoing treatment.

Jai Lal Paswan, Bagirath’s brother, told the police that Bagirath and Uskeen returned from work at 7 pm on Thursday and had their dinner. Later, the duo consumed cannabis and country-made liquor, and went to sleep. Around 2 am on Friday, Bagirath started feeling uneasiness and went outside to attend the nature’s call.

Jai Lal further said Bagirath again complained of uneasiness around 4 am and fell unconscious. Uskeen too was found lying unconscious in his room, his family members said.

Jai Lal then brought the matter to the knowledge of their landlord, who immediately rushed them to the Civil Hospital, where they died while undergoing treatment.

The Investigating Officer said the duo seemed to have died of excessive consumption of cannabis and liquor. He ruled out any foul play.  — OC
